King of The Monsters’ Actor Thomas Middleditch Reportedly Joins The Cast of ‘Zombieland

While filming has been underway in Atlanta on Ruben Fleischer’s Zombieland 2: Double Tap since last month, there is yet another addition to the cast revealed by Variety.

Comedian Thomas Middleditch has taken an undisclosed role in the film, assumed to be a human survivor. Middleditch is likely best known from the HBO series Silicon Valley and will have a supporting role Godzilla: King of the Monsters. He’ll join fellow newcomers, Rosario Dawson, and Zoey Deutch in the horror comedy.

Double Tap was penned by Zombieland/Deadpool screenwriters Paul Wernick and Rhett Reese along with Dave Callaham (Wonder Woman 1984, Shang-Chi, The Expendables). The group from the original film returns as played by Emma Stone, Woody Harrelson, Jesse Eisenberg, and Abigail Breslin. In the sequel, they’ll face multiple new types of zombies and will encounter fellow survivors.

Set in a world in which zombie slayers must face off against many new kinds of zombies that have evolved since the first movie, as well as some new human survivors.

It’ll be interesting to see how they plan on ramping up the action as the sequel’s title would suggest as some of the new zombies are tougher to kill and we could see a bit more action/gore than the first installment considering it’s a post-Walking Dead era and a zombie movie is likely going to need to turn up the volume to add anything new to the zombie genre.

Sony Pictures has given Zombieland 2: Double Tap a release date of October 11th.
